At Kidderminster Station, buying and collecting tickets is hassle-free. The ticket office is open from 06:10 to 19:00 on weekdays, with slightly reduced hours on weekends. For those preferring digital transactions, ticket machines are available and accessible to all visitors. Additionally, for those with auditory needs, induction loops are conveniently installed. While Smartcards are not issued or validated here, the station ensures ticket collection for online purchases is swift and simple.
Kidderminster Station is proudly recognized for its accessibility, classified as a category A station. This means step-free access to all platforms, ensuring ease of travel for wheelchair users and those with limited mobility. The lack of ticket barriers further facilitates unrestricted movement. Assistance is consistently available with the friendly staff, ready to provide support during the ticket office hours. Accessible facilities are diligently maintained, yes, including toilets and seating areas. Unfortunately, baby changing facilities and waiting rooms are not part of the station’s offerings, but the warm staff presence compensates for that.

Brading Station may not feature a ticket office or ticket machines, but it maintains its focus on providing a seamless travel experience. Travelers can find an induction loop for those who require hearing assistance, and CCTV ensures safety across the premises. Although waiting rooms aren't available, passengers can rest at the seating areas while waiting for their train. Note that the toilets are conveniently located on the platform but are only open during the summer months.
There is no baggage storage here, so plan accordingly. During the sunnier months from April to September, the station offers refreshments, adding a touch of local flavor to your journey. While bicycle storage isn't available, enthusiasts can rejoice in Shanklin's summer cycle hire available from the heritage center located in the station building.
Brading Station is partially accessible. Step-free access is offered primarily on platforms, although reaching some areas requires navigating ramps and a railway crossing. This crossing requires wheelchair users and those needing additional time to contact the signaller using yellow phones for a safe passage. It's advisable to arrive 10-15 minutes early to ensure a smooth connection to outbound trains. There is customer support available through help points, but for broader assistance, passengers can lean on the Guard onboard the train.
Despite its simpler amenities, Brading Station ensures you won't be stranded. In instances of disruptions, rail replacement services are available, with buses stopping at local road points.
